基于单片机的霓虹灯控制器设计.doc
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
霓虹灯控制器设计是电子工程领域中一个有趣的实践项目,特别是在单片机应用技术中具有重要地位。基于单片机的霓虹灯控制器利用微处理器的高效计算能力,实现对霓虹灯显示的精确控制,使得灯光效果更加丰富多彩,同时提高了系统的可编程性和灵活性。 在第1章“绪论”中,1.1节“选题的背景与意义”可能会探讨以下几个方面: 1. **背景**:随着科技的发展,传统霓虹灯逐渐被LED照明取代,因其节能、环保和寿命长的优点。然而,LED霓虹灯的控制需求增加,需要智能化、动态化的显示效果,这就催生了基于单片机的控制器设计需求。 2. **意义**:设计这样的控制器可以提升霓虹灯的显示效果,满足个性化定制的需求,如动态图案、文字滚动等。同时,通过单片机控制,可以实现远程操作、多灯同步等高级功能,为广告、装饰、娱乐等领域提供创新解决方案。 在第2章“系统总体设计”中,2.1节“方案的选择”可能讨论了不同设计方案的比较,包括硬件选型、软件策略等。2.2节则进一步阐述了系统的整体架构,包括关键器件74HC595(一种串行输入并行输出的移位寄存器)用于驱动LED点阵,以及LED点阵的基本工作原理。 第3章“硬件设计”深入到硬件层面,3.1节详细介绍了硬件组件的选择和论证。主控电路选择可能涉及到常用的单片机如STM8或AVR系列,这些单片机具有足够的处理能力和I/O接口,适合驱动LED。显示设备即LED点阵,可能讨论了其亮度、颜色、分辨率等参数。控制器模块选择可能包括电源管理、时钟源、复位电路等。3.2节接着展示了各个硬件模块的电路设计,如单片机最小系统、点阵驱动、红外遥控等。 第4章“软件设计”涵盖了程序开发的部分。4.1节描述了系统运行的基本流程,包括主程序逻辑和I/O口分配,这是控制器功能实现的关键。4.2节则涉及具体模块的程序设计,如显示程序负责LED点阵的点亮顺序和亮度控制,红外接收程序处理来自遥控器的指令,实现用户交互。 总结来说,这个项目涵盖了单片机原理、数字电路、嵌入式系统、软件编程等多个IT领域的知识,对于学习者来说,既能提升理论素养,也能锻炼实践能力。通过这样的设计,我们可以构建出一个能够灵活控制LED霓虹灯的智能控制器,满足多样化和动态化的显示需求。
剩余19页未读,继续阅读
- 粉丝: 92
- 资源: 2万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- index(3).html
- Python 实现BiLSTM-Adaboost和BiLSTM多变量时间序列预测对比(含完整的程序和代码详解)
- 电子硬件产品使用与配置全解析手册
- Matlab实现基于TSOA-CNN-GRU-Attention的数据分类预测(含完整的程序和代码详解)
- EXCEL使用函数将16进制转浮点数
- MATLAB实现基于AHC聚类算法可视化(含完整的程序和代码详解)
- MATLAB实现ZOA-CNN-BiGRU-Attention多变量时间序列预测(含完整的程序和代码详解)
- 860662665747408所有整合1.zip
- JavaWeb深度剖析:从基础知识到框架实践全攻略
- 上市公司诚信承诺数据集(2000-2023).xlsx